3. Maximum load weight
- Maximum cargo load: 10,000 lb (5 tons). The Customer agrees not to load the trailer beyond this limit regardless of how much volume space remains.
- An overloaded trailer will not be hauled. The Customer remains responsible for the full service fee plus a $250 overload reload fee and must remove material until the load is legal.
- Heavy materials (concrete, dirt, sand, asphalt, brick, tile, stone, gravel) must not exceed the marked fill line inside the trailer, approximately one-third of the wall height. A $100 heavy-material surcharge applies to these loads.
4. Prohibited items
The following are not accepted under any circumstances. The Customer is responsible for proper disposal of any of these:
- Hazardous materials of any kind (paint, solvents, chemicals, pesticides, fertilizers)
- Tires
- Refrigerators, freezers, and air conditioners (require certified freon evacuation)
- Batteries (auto, marine, lithium-ion)
- Asbestos or lead paint debris
- Liquid waste of any kind
- Propane tanks (full or empty)
- Electronics waste (TVs, computers, monitors)
- Medical or biohazardous waste
- Ammunition, fireworks, or explosives
